**Embracing a Growth Mindset**

At the heart of a culture of continuous learning lies the concept of a growth mindset. Coined by psychologist Carol Dweck, a growth mindset emphasizes the belief that abilities and intelligence can be developed through dedication and hard work. Leaders who foster a growth mindset within their teams encourage resilience, curiosity, and a willingness to embrace challenges as opportunities for growth. By reframing failures as learning experiences and celebrating progress over perfection, organizations can create an environment that nurtures creativity and innovation.

**Encouraging Lifelong Learning**

In today's knowledge-based economy, the pace of change requires individuals to engage in lifelong learning to stay relevant and competitive. Organizations can support continuous skill development by providing learning opportunities such as workshops, seminars, online courses, and mentorship programs. Encouraging employees to pursue professional development not only enhances their capabilities but also fosters a culture of continuous improvement and adaptability. By investing in the growth and development of their workforce, organizations cultivate a talented and agile team capable of navigating challenges and seizing opportunities.

**Promoting Knowledge Sharing and Collaboration**

Collaboration is a cornerstone of a learning culture, enabling individuals to leverage collective expertise and diverse perspectives to drive innovation. Encouraging knowledge sharing through cross-functional projects, team brainstorming sessions, and feedback mechanisms fosters a sense of community and mutual support. When employees feel empowered to share their insights and collaborate on solutions, organizations benefit from a wealth of ideas and perspectives that can lead to breakthrough innovations and process improvements. By fostering a collaborative environment built on trust and respect, organizations can harness the collective intelligence of their teams to tackle complex challenges and drive organizational growth.

**Adapting to Change and Uncertainty**

In a rapidly evolving business landscape, adaptability is a critical skill for both individuals and organizations. Leaders must cultivate a culture that embraces change and uncertainty, encouraging agility and resilience in the face of challenges. By promoting a growth mindset and continuous learning, organizations can equip their teams with the skills and mindset needed to navigate ambiguity and seize opportunities for growth. Embracing change as a constant and fostering a culture of adaptability not only prepares organizations for the future but also instills a sense of confidence and empowerment among employees.
